Problem z przypisaniem administratora do podmiotu

Dzień dobry.
Mamy problem z wykonaniem w KUiP czynności przypisania administratora/administratorów do podmiotu. Działając zgodnie z opisem zawartym w instrukcji opisanej w podręczniku EZD RP, tj.: https://podrecznik.ezdrp.gov.pl/zarzadzania-podmiotami-i-uzytkownikami-system-kuip/ tworzymy najpierw nowy podmiot (krok 1. instrukcji), następnie tworzymy ręcznie 2 użytkowników, którzy mają być administratorami naszego podmiot (krok 2. instrukcji).
Problem pojawia się przy kroku 3. instrukcji “KUiP - przypisanie uprawnień administracyjnych”. Polega on na tym, że gdy w polach “Administrator 1” i/lub “Administrator 2” wskażemy ww. użytkowników, a następnie klikniemy przycisk “ZAPISZ”, pojawia się komunikat z błędem o treści: “Pojawił się błąd w aplikacji, który został zarejestrowany pod numerem d27090e17cd449f6b71cbc1d052a6fee.” (załączam zrzut ekranu z komunikatem błędu).

Będę wdzięczny za pomoc w wyjaśnieniu co oznacza ww. błąd oraz w jego rozwiązaniu.

Dodam, że pomimo wystąpienia opisanego wyżej błędu system zachowuje się tak, jakby mimo wszystko uprawnienia administratora zostały nadane, ponieważ po odświeżeniu strony dane użytkownika/-ów wskazanego/-ych w polach “Administrator 1” i/lub “Administrator 2” pozostają zachowane a użytkownicy ci otrzymują powiadomienie mailowe z informacją o nadaniu uprawnień administratora podmiotu.

Mamy podejrzenie, że zgłaszany w niniejszym wątku problem być może jest przyczyną problemu z brakiem możliwości zalogowania się do aplikacji EZD na konto administratora, który zgłosiłem wcześniej w wątku:

W związku z powyższym uprzejmie proszę o zweryfikowanie ew. powiązania obydwu problemów.

Mam w KUiP podobny komunikat, tylko wyświetla mi się podczas dodawania pojedynczego usera.

Jeżeli w dalszym ciągu macie problem @tomdzieg @szychowski dodajcie proszę logi (workloads → pods → kuip-api… → trzy kropki (kebab) → view logs → download)

{"@t":"2024-09-22T18:58:36.5948504Z","@mt":"Connection {type} established to broker {broker}, port {port}","type":"Producer","broker":"10.10.10.110","port":5672,"SourceContext":"EasyNetLogger","ApplicationName":"KUIP","UID":"root","PID":"system","RequestId":"0HN6R7077NM5E:00000005","RequestPath":"/kuip/podmiot-aktualizacja-administratorow","ConnectionId":"0HN6R7077NM5E","ConsoleLogger":"true","IceHost":"KUIP","InstanceName":"test.mojadomena.pl","SeqLogger":"true"}
{"@t":"2024-09-22T18:58:36.6713204Z","@mt":"Connection {type} blocked with reason {reason}","type":"Producer","reason":"low on disk","SourceContext":"EasyNetLogger","ApplicationName":"KUIP","UID":"root","PID":"system","RequestId":"0HN6R7077NM5E:00000005","RequestPath":"/kuip/podmiot-aktualizacja-administratorow","ConnectionId":"0HN6R7077NM5E","ConsoleLogger":"true","IceHost":"KUIP","InstanceName":"test.mojadomena.pl","SeqLogger":"true"}
{"@t":"2024-09-22T18:58:46.6654405Z","@mt":"A task was canceled.","@l":"Error","@x":"System.Threading.Tasks.TaskCanceledException: A task was canceled.\n   at EasyNetQ.Producer.PublishConfirmationListener.PublishPendingConfirmation.WaitAsync(CancellationToken cancellationToken)\n   at EasyNetQ.RabbitAdvancedBus.PublishAsync(Exchange exchange, String routingKey, Boolean mandatory, MessageProperties properties, ReadOnlyMemory`1 body, CancellationToken cancellationToken)\n   at .ProcessMessage(IMessage , IReadOnlyDictionary`2 )\n   at KUIP.AppServices.AsCommands.Podmioty.Commands.AktualizujAdministratorowHandler.InvokeAsync(AktualizujAdministratorowCommand input, Dictionary`2 properties)\n   at .(ICommandDto , Dictionary`2 , Type , ICommandHandlerBase )\n   at .Handle(IContainerScope , ICommandDto , Func`1 )\n   at .Handle(ICommandDto , Dictionary`2 )\n   at .Receive(IContainerScope , ICommandDto , Func`1 )\n   at (TaskAwaiter`1& )\n   at .Handle(HttpContext , Type )\n   at ...MoveNext()\n--- End of stack trace from previous location ---\n   at Microsoft.AspNetCore.Routing.EndpointMiddleware.<Invoke>g__AwaitRequestTask|6_0(Endpoint endpoint, Task requestTask, ILogger logger)\n   at ...MoveNext()","ErrorResponseBody":"{\n  \"errorId\": \"e384d9d050df45d4bd779cc3281936da\",\n  \"instance\": \"/kuip/podmiot-aktualizacja-administratorow\",\n  \"status\": 500,\n  \"type\": \"https://httpstatuses.io/500\",\n  \"title\": \"HTTP error InternalServerError\"\n}","ErrorId":"e384d9d050df45d4bd779cc3281936da","SourceContext":"LoggerMiddleware","ApplicationName":"KUIP","UID":"root","PID":"system","RequestId":"0HN6R7077NM5E:00000005","RequestPath":"/kuip/podmiot-aktualizacja-administratorow","ConnectionId":"0HN6R7077NM5E","ExceptionDetail":{"Type":"System.Threading.Tasks.TaskCanceledException","HResult":-2146233029,"Message":"A task was canceled.","Source":"System.Private.CoreLib","TargetSite":"Void ThrowForNonSuccess(System.Threading.Tasks.Task)","CancellationToken":"CancellationRequested: true","Task":{"Id":1,"Status":"Canceled","CreationOptions":"RunContinuationsAsynchronously"}},"ConsoleLogger":"true","IceHost":"KUIP","InstanceName":"test.mojadomena.pl","SeqLogger":"true"}

Jest błąd dot. braku miejsca na dysku, ale nic na to nie wskazuje:

Filesystem      1K-blocks     Used  Available Use% Mounted on
tmpfs             6577452     7336    6570116   1% /run
/dev/sda2       129407108 29527608   93259804  25% /
tmpfs            32887256     1052   32886204   1% /dev/shm
tmpfs                5120        0       5120   0% /run/lock
/dev/sda1         1098628     6228    1092400   1% /boot/efi
/dev/sdb       4259966888      132 4045202008   1% /nfs
shm                 65536        0      65536   0% /run/k3s/containerd/io.containerd.grpc.v1.cri/sandboxes/17cfb41e9c0f71958471c33d394cbfca5dea23d8171a2cf521ea40b3fe148163/shm
shm                 65536        0      65536   0% /run/k3s/containerd/io.containerd.grpc.v1.cri/sandboxes/77ef8568668473b2f4f2b0b17c7f336f99b4a45ebe9c6a1f0ba573bec92b33b2/shm
shm                 65536        0      65536   0% /run/k3s/containerd/io.containerd.grpc.v1.cri/sandboxes/93e3cf7b667d1e8dc4aef076833347447a96a41642de450f4052fcfe4dbc5079/shm
shm                 65536        0      65536   0% /run/k3s/containerd/io.containerd.grpc.v1.cri/sandboxes/24543abe1c11e683ed02bb3297be3d06c2f46d4c914c4f5500f73fce25f06ab4/shm
shm                 65536        0      65536   0% /run/k3s/containerd/io.containerd.grpc.v1.cri/sandboxes/9cd0847f22f4d3df60f2047ed9e94273433f2d3346c147219ab3917bef28b80b/shm
shm                 65536        0      65536   0% /run/k3s/containerd/io.containerd.grpc.v1.cri/sandboxes/2a8cb9a4a9aef2fd62973321e517026b827b3c0d7a4276ae72586ea71c9b68bc/shm
shm                 65536        0      65536   0% /run/k3s/containerd/io.containerd.grpc.v1.cri/sandboxes/e7c6d82bd8bc1170073bfec2572b861fafdb64e3a5d0b8f07ece0141197a0b01/shm
shm                 65536        0      65536   0% /run/k3s/containerd/io.containerd.grpc.v1.cri/sandboxes/b0586f3a269c3dd38dcd1d6de0083729f6ab8517de2af53e15b04be0af12c7f6/shm
shm                 65536        0      65536   0% /run/k3s/containerd/io.containerd.grpc.v1.cri/sandboxes/19825e5ab4eca0337bd7d0b141dfb1cd36c8f5dec827683894088d1accae7fb4/shm
shm                 65536        0      65536   0% /run/k3s/containerd/io.containerd.grpc.v1.cri/sandboxes/cffe4c7f02e78993f30cad216d5f5dd2365da05b9dfb1626671037e330c75049/shm
shm                 65536        0      65536   0% /run/k3s/containerd/io.containerd.grpc.v1.cri/sandboxes/0d3b272cd5f6c2ba75cf19c8ba478042db87970f118ba94f83d6a3a914a6e958/shm
shm                 65536        0      65536   0% /run/k3s/containerd/io.containerd.grpc.v1.cri/sandboxes/755fd13e696f055cd488ced22743469f4e9981498b4334f5a7c1cd2d31b72ebc/shm
shm                 65536        0      65536   0% /run/k3s/containerd/io.containerd.grpc.v1.cri/sandboxes/0ff2fa1b513c548b7be822190da35f07186139fb80259de2bf931a40ef211ddc/shm
shm                 65536        0      65536   0% /run/k3s/containerd/io.containerd.grpc.v1.cri/sandboxes/0a758a31a14f4a1ffa91557923102a2059c028658e6a3aee148def8dd1c0cfe7/shm
shm                 65536        0      65536   0% /run/k3s/containerd/io.containerd.grpc.v1.cri/sandboxes/bee3550efcaef1934d68c49256b20939c3f71454cf1d5ba6d435d504840aa896/shm
shm                 65536        0      65536   0% /run/k3s/containerd/io.containerd.grpc.v1.cri/sandboxes/7ddc13ccaa40090961bb906b08f526c4dae9660446a342b48532b651896b7c8d/shm
shm                 65536        0      65536   0% /run/k3s/containerd/io.containerd.grpc.v1.cri/sandboxes/aced5990aafb846e2f2d7f5a3afb3011a868e72f58df28929e570743e5c75b43/shm
shm                 65536        8      65528   1% /run/k3s/containerd/io.containerd.grpc.v1.cri/sandboxes/f8c6d52f234055905f7e6472562d221c52ba92ecd651057d69bf8c659900863f/shm
shm                 65536       96      65440   1% /run/k3s/containerd/io.containerd.grpc.v1.cri/sandboxes/0dac5bd5d3a6edc61ba53284db651bc4825d6c193249a52bc88880bccb64017d/shm
shm                 65536        8      65528   1% /run/k3s/containerd/io.containerd.grpc.v1.cri/sandboxes/9a3cccf9ec7c587c2b32452b3d9280cd6384061bda6a25905ce76325e1436ce6/shm
shm                 65536        0      65536   0% /run/k3s/containerd/io.containerd.grpc.v1.cri/sandboxes/193bf14700e26b5da21b559d73f59f11059effd396b48834e11f243df391b317/shm
shm                 65536        8      65528   1% /run/k3s/containerd/io.containerd.grpc.v1.cri/sandboxes/49f4514f0ab2954d5989a7ac5abf8677c42449b1962859247711135322d2584f/shm
shm                 65536        0      65536   0% /run/k3s/containerd/io.containerd.grpc.v1.cri/sandboxes/774e302c317d9f6d0096e56387735a6d5a114003ccd171800c6a617f928a8a9c/shm
shm                 65536        8      65528   1% /run/k3s/containerd/io.containerd.grpc.v1.cri/sandboxes/c36de02a2e2bae15a7eb504086f89042b9c05bb2b02d4116cbbcf1585d890744/shm
shm                 65536        8      65528   1% /run/k3s/containerd/io.containerd.grpc.v1.cri/sandboxes/d603cc0ff8fa132035e2ff4b725169bdd12cf64af3460de896324436e68d776f/shm
shm                 65536        0      65536   0% /run/k3s/containerd/io.containerd.grpc.v1.cri/sandboxes/0f12331dc03f42b577336a347215b39d8322804266b53610d2ba686c8d3ec4f9/shm
shm                 65536        8      65528   1% /run/k3s/containerd/io.containerd.grpc.v1.cri/sandboxes/0038e7ebe6e43884def384934d3c8994ac8b8ad7378e008647341e9cd54293d3/shm
shm                 65536        0      65536   0% /run/k3s/containerd/io.containerd.grpc.v1.cri/sandboxes/62dac632d75ea27de3f12bddda142527d5e2fb7e08649998d0d041f273e9968f/shm
shm                 65536        8      65528   1% /run/k3s/containerd/io.containerd.grpc.v1.cri/sandboxes/f87cb45d317c8d713b774e47f6329dfff49a06a07d28137cb44359bf00af987f/shm
shm                 65536        8      65528   1% /run/k3s/containerd/io.containerd.grpc.v1.cri/sandboxes/eb92a81398aaffee34f88608f2292a05ba53f1f6579db00e6713bb7fd15cfd0b/shm
shm                 65536        0      65536   0% /run/k3s/containerd/io.containerd.grpc.v1.cri/sandboxes/07ef9d64777a7bba4d4f63015c2d88eeef1292ad20f0ca884e799557414f26d5/shm
shm                 65536        0      65536   0% /run/k3s/containerd/io.containerd.grpc.v1.cri/sandboxes/08f92a1f810850ce489b61e71e31833861eac323eda2267181ce61c4d4bab475/shm
shm                 65536        0      65536   0% /run/k3s/containerd/io.containerd.grpc.v1.cri/sandboxes/2455441b74c59cfe518fe81d0dcef726d51d2037360772809a098b19a4069b7f/shm
shm                 65536        8      65528   1% /run/k3s/containerd/io.containerd.grpc.v1.cri/sandboxes/1a23b6857c842830e492a9525cf2b2cd7ffa9eea4db09d6992677d33dce32027/shm
shm                 65536        8      65528   1% /run/k3s/containerd/io.containerd.grpc.v1.cri/sandboxes/fde2ec9e55848202d44136d50f9a8cc53593a42a31c1a8ebbe3b8e4085ac4c65/shm
tmpfs             6577448        4    6577444   1% /run/user/1000

Przy jednej instalacji miałem ten sam problem (dysk 50GB, wolne 20GB i komunikat “lon on disk”). Rozszerzyłem dysk do 100GB i ruszyło.

Dzięki - pomogło zwiększenie /dev/sda2 (93GB było za mało - ciekawe co miał na myśli autor tego warunku w kodzie).

Obstawiam warunek procentowy i stąd te problemy. Fajnie, że się udało :ok_hand: